Child killed in Khulna after being hit by e-bike

A child has died after being hit by an e-bike at Khulna Sadar upazila on Wednesday.


The accident occurred around 4:00 PM at South Mohammad Nagar Switchgate area under Labanchara Police Station.


The deceased was identified as Muntajin, 5, son of Saddam Sardar, a resident of Kalabagi village under Dakop upazila in the district.


Confirming the incident, Labanchara Police Station officer-in-charge (OC) Hawladar Sanwar Hossain Masum said that an e-bike driver hit the child and left him critically injured at the scene.


Later, locals rescued and rushed him to Khulna Medical College Hospital (KMCH) where he died around around 7 PM.


Following the incident, locals beat the e-bike driver, Asadul Islam, before handing him over to the police. He is now under treatment at KMCH prison cell.
